    To grasp the concept of decimal equivalents, let's break down what happens when a fraction is converted into a decimal. A decimal equivalent represents the proportion or ratio between two numbers. When a fraction is expressed in decimal format, it takes the form of a number followed by a decimal point and digits to the right. For example, the fraction 3 4 can be expressed as 0.75 in decimal format. This conversion involves dividing the numerator (3) by the denominator (4) to obtain the quotient, which represents the decimal equivalent.

      Decimals play a crucial role in various aspects of our lives, including finance, engineering, and science. They provide a precise way to represent numbers, especially in situations where fractions are not suitable. For instance, calculating interest rates, converting between units of measurement, and computing geometric shapes all rely on decimal representations.
